    摘要:

    本文研究了部分相干电磁反常涡旋光束(PCEAVB) 通过各向异性non-Kolmogorov大气湍流后的偏振 度和偏振态的变化。研究结果表明,PCEAVB的偏振度分布为同心的圆环,而随着光束阶数n和拓扑荷数 m的增大,同心圆环数逐渐增加,分布越密集。光束阶数n越高、拓扑荷数m越低,高偏振度 分布区域越 趋于中间区域;反之,则趋于外环分布。PCEAVB的偏振态随着传输距离z的增 加由均匀线偏振变成非均 匀线偏振,偏振角呈现圆环状分布,且偏振角较大的区域随着传输距离z的增大而逐渐向外 环移动。拓扑 荷数m越大、光束阶数n越小,PCEAVB的偏振角较大的区域越靠近 于中心区域。而且光束阶数n和拓扑 荷数m越大的PCEAVB,偏振态受到湍流的影响越小。且各向异性越强的大气湍 流对PCEAVB的影响越小,光束演化得越慢。

    Abstract:

    We have studied the degree of polarization (DOP) and the state of pol arization (SOP) of partially coherent electromagnetic anomalous vortex beam (PCEAVB) through anisotropic non -Kolmogorov atmospheric turbulence.The results show that the distributions of DOP present concentric ri ng,and the number of concentric rings will increase with the increasing of beam order n and topological charge m.And the relative high DOP distribution region tends to the middle region with the increasing of beam order n and the decreasing of topological charge m,otherwise,it tends to the outer ring distributi on.We can also find that the SOP distributions of PCEAVB will change from uniform linear polarization into nonuniform linear polarization with the increasing of propagation distance z,and the polarization angle shows the circular distribution.And the region with large polarization angle gradually moves to the outer ring with the increasing of prop agation distance z.The big polarization angle region of PCEAVB with the bigger topological charge m and smaller beam order n is closer to the central region.Moreover,the larger beam order n and topological charge m,the less influence of atmospheric turbulence on the SOP of PCEAVB.It can be also found that PCEAVB is less effect ed by the non-Kolmogorov atmospheric turbulence with strong anisotropy and the beams will evolve more slo wly.
